Croix-Bleue Medavie Stadium
Stadium
Photo: Ashoola,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Croix-Bleue Medavie Stadium, formerly Moncton Stadium, is a track and field stadium on the campus of the Université de Moncton in Moncton, New Brunswick, Canada, built to host the IAAF 2010 World Junior Championships in Athletics. Croix-Bleue Medavie Stadium is situated 390 metres northwest of Pavillon Léopold-Taillon.
Maison Lafrance
Residential building
Photo: Stu pendousmat,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Résidence Lafrance, is a co-ed dormitory on the campus of the Université de Moncton in Moncton, New Brunswick, Canada. It is named after abbot Xavier-François Lafrance, the first resident priest of the Tracadie parish. Maison Lafrance is situated 420 metres southwest of Pavillon Léopold-Taillon.
Resurgo Place
Museum
Photo: Stu pendousmat,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Resurgo Place in Moncton, New Brunswick, Canada is the new home of the Moncton Museum, the Transportation Discovery Centre and also houses the main Moncton Visitor Information Centre. Resurgo Place is situated 1¼ km south of Pavillon Léopold-Taillon.

Moncton
Photo: Stu pendousmat,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Moncton is a city in Southeastern New Brunswick, Canada, inland of the Bay of Fundy and Acadian Coast. Moncton has a population of about 72,000, with a metropolitan population of about 145,000, making it the largest city and the largest metropolitan city in New Brunswick.
